As a Senior Recruiter Creative & Media, you will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of DEPT® by developing and implementing strategic talent acquisition initiatives for the Creative & Media service teams across EMEA.

DEPT® is a Growth Invention company operating at the intersection of technology and marketing. Its specialists deliver services across Brand & Media, Experience, Commerce, CRM, and Technology & Data.

You will embody DEPT®'s culture as the initial ambassador for candidates, ensuring a seamless and positive experience throughout their recruitment journey. By collaborating closely with leadership teams, you will gain a deep understanding of role requirements, deliver regular updates on hiring progress, and offer valuable market insights to support informed decision-making.

Job purpose

As a Senior Recruiter, you will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of our agency by developing and implementing strategic talent acquisition initiatives for our Creative & Media service teams across EMEA.

What you’ll do

  • Alongside the Head of, develop and implement the talent strategy for Creative & Media services across key EMEA markets.
  • Operate as a trusted advisor to senior leadership, managing expectations, challenging briefs when needed, and turning difficult hiring requests into realistic, fillable mandates.
  • Use data to lead decision-making by turning hiring intelligence into insights that shape leadership decisions and remove blockers.
  • Drive innovation across the function through new sourcing channels, AI-enabled tooling, and assessment approaches.
  • Build and own proactive talent pipelines and market maps so searches never start cold.
  • Headhunt directly for senior talent through LinkedIn Recruiter and personal networks, targeting passive candidates at rival networks and boutiques.
  • Represent DEPT® in the market at industry events, on panels, and in the talent community, building employer brand and long-term networks.
  • Champion candidate experience across EMEA, ensuring every future Depster experiences the "small enough to care" side of the company from first contact.
  • Raise the bar across the recruiting team by sharing playbooks, mentoring others, and improving recruiting practices.

What you’ll bring

  • Significant in-house recruitment experience, ideally within a creative, media, digital, or integrated agency environment.
  • A track record of hiring across multiple EMEA markets, with the ability to adapt search strategies by location.
  • Confidence managing senior stakeholders in a matrix organisation and leading hiring strategies.
  • Strong direct-sourcing capability, including Boolean search, market mapping, and pedigree mapping across competitors.
  • Data fluency and the ability to build and defend a hiring story with metrics.
  • Navigational intelligence and the instinct to get things done inside a global, fast-moving, partner-led organisation.
  • A proactive and autonomous mindset, balanced with curiosity and a drive to keep reinventing hiring approaches.
